    Redpath’s Cowal underground contract: design and scheduling notes for engineers

    First reported on International Mining – News

    30 Second Briefing

    Redpath Mining has secured a five-year underground mining contract at Evolution Mining’s Cowal Gold Operations in New South Wales, with an early ramp-up scheduled for 2026 and full-scale development and production from July 2026. The contractor is already recruiting across multiple underground roles, signalling a build-out of crews and equipment ahead of portal establishment and development drilling. For geotechnical and mining engineers, the timeline points to imminent demand for ground support design, ventilation planning and production scheduling integrated with Cowal’s existing open-pit infrastructure.

    EnergyX–Compass Minerals Utah lithium plant: project and capex lens for mine planners

    EnergyX has signed an MoU with Compass Minerals to build a 30,000 tpa direct lithium extraction and refining plant at Compass’s existing Ogden brine operation near Utah’s Great Salt Lake, using an established brine stream and returning processed brine to the current sulphate of potash and magnesium chloride system. Compass has already invested an estimated $70–80 million in lithium-related equipment, cutting upstream drilling and CapEx risk and potentially simplifying permitting. EnergyX is targeting a 2028 construction start and plans to produce lithium carbonate on-site without additional Great Salt Lake water withdrawals.

    MinRes Bald Hill lithium restart: ramp‑up, output and JV lens for mine planners

    Mineral Resources is restarting the Bald Hill lithium mine in Western Australia after an 18‑month shutdown, bringing back a 58 Mt resource grading 0.9% Li₂O and nameplate output of 165,000 dmt per year of 5.1% spodumene concentrate (about 140,000 dmt SC6 equivalent). Ramp‑up will see crushing and mining restart next month, first concentrate in July, first shipment via the Port of Esperance in Q1 FY2027 and full capacity in Q2. Once online, MinRes will be the only operator running three hard‑rock lithium mines with on‑site concentrate plants, alongside Wodgina and Mt Marion.

    EU ban on Russian uranium: supply and contract outlook for mine planners

    Mounting EU pressure to phase out Russian uranium and fuel services, which still provide about 25% of the bloc’s enrichment via Rosatom’s 43% share of global capacity, is pushing utilities towards Canadian supply, with Canada already covering more than 30% of EU uranium imports in 2024. Cameco, owner of 49% of Westinghouse, is positioned to capture long-term contracts as AP1000 reactor projects advance in Poland and Bulgaria and VVER units in Finland, Bulgaria, Slovakia and Ukraine convert to Western fuel. Analysts warn, however, that replacing Russian enrichment could take up to a decade due to limited Western capacity.
